请先配置安装好Java的环境,若没有安装,请参照我以下的步骤进行安装!

请先配置安装好Java的环境,若没有安装,请参照我以下的步骤进行安装!

请先配置安装好Java的环境,若没有安装,请参照我以下上的步骤进行安装!

重要的事情说三遍!!!

安装Java环境教程

https://blog.csdn.net/qq_40881680/article/details/83585542

若不知道Java环境是否已经安装配置环境完成,cmd窗口输入 java 回车

目录

Tomcat下载教程

Tomcat安装教程

Tomcat配置环境变量教程

Tomcat启动和验证配置环境变量是否成功

常见问题

Tomcat下载教程

首先确定你Windows系统是64位,还是32位(现在大部分是64位)

查看操作系统位数步骤:(WindowsXP,Windows7,Windows8,Windows10查看步骤大同小异,举例Windows10)

Windows键+E 组合键打开页面

确定好后进入官网下载Tomcat,官网地址-点击进入 http://tomcat.apache.org/

选择左侧的Tomcat版本,本篇文章举例Tomcat9,其它的版本安装都一样

点击Tomcat9

进入Tomcat9下载页面

对应着操作系统位数进行下载,下载后会是一个zip压缩包

Tomcat安装教程

解压压缩包,放在想要放在的盘符(C盘、D盘...无所谓,记着路径就可以)

就比如安装在D盘,那就解压出来放在D盘下就行,里面的文件名不要改动,或者放在D盘某一文件夹下,路径不要包含中文和特殊字符!

这一句话说的太苛刻了,你若熟悉安装,可以不用按我说的来

放到这里即可

Tomcat配置环境变量教程

环境变量配置就如上述的 下载教程 ,进入如下页面

点击高级系统设置

选中高级,点击环境变量

在系统变量栏中选择新建

之后出现如下图,

在变量名中填写: CATALINA_HOME

变量值就是你解压后的路径,你可以直接进入解压后的文件夹,点击如图部分,复制这个路径到变量值

特别注意:

在变量值中填写路径;路径就是你解压后Tomcat的文件夹路径,就如上述,那么路径就是: D:\apache-tomcat-9.0.12

若解压到了其他盘符,如C盘,那就是 C:\apache-tomcat-9.0.12

放在了某个文件夹下那路径就是 :

盘符: \ 某文件夹 \ 解压后的tomcat整体文件夹(这里是apache-tomcat-9.0.12,看看你解压的文件夹名是什么)

千万别整错了!!!!!!!(感觉自己好啰嗦,这是和小白说的,新手配置要注意了)

好了,现在点击这个确定,就添加进去了

之后再找到系统变量中的Path(不要说没有,好好找找,绝对有)

之后再点击编辑文本

若弹出对话框点击确定

如图,在最后面追加    %CATALINA_HOME%\bin;

(小提示:你可以直接按电脑上的 End 键 到最后)

分号结尾,第一个%前面若没有分号,请手动打上去分号,分号是英文状态下输入的,特别注意

之后点击如上图的确定(新手配置不要瞎点)

之后又到了下图,再点击确定(不要点别的)

之后到了下图页面,再点击确定就配好环境变量了(哎呀妈呀真费劲,为了第一次的小白配置,只能这么写了)

Tomcat启动和验证配置环境变量是否成功

Windows键+R,输入cmd,回车

输入 startup.bat 后回车(你也可以到你解压的tomcat文件夹下的bin目录中点击startup.bat)

之后出现了Tomcat的启动窗口,若没有报错或者一闪而过,那么说明启动成功了,让黑窗口保持运行,不能关,否则你的服务器也就关闭了,若出现了报错或者一闪而过(启动失败),可能是你的端口被占用,Tomcat默认的端口是8080,出现这两种情况那么可以试试以下两种:

一、重启电脑后再次按以上步骤启动Tomcat尝试是否能解决;

二、修改Tomcat端口号后重启电脑,再用以上步骤启动Tomcat。

等等,重启前先把这篇文章的地址保存一下,或者直接关注我,待会你可能会找不到了

之后验证环境变量是否配置成功,浏览器输入一下 http://localhost:8080

可以直接点击进入http://localhost:8080/

出现如下图,那么就说明配置成功了

over,关注我一下吧,或者给我点个赞!

常见问题
1、startup.bat启动后,显示中文乱码,并且http://localhost:8080/能正常访问

找到tomcat 配置下的server.xml文件。

修改编码格式 UTF-8:

<Connector port="8054" protocol="HTTP/1.1"

connectionTimeout="20000"

redirectPort="8443" URIEncoding="UTF-8"/>

Tomcat服务器下载、安装、配置环境变量教程(超详细)的更多相关文章

  1. 渗透开源工具之sqlmap安装配置环境变量教程

    由于计算机安全牵涉到很多方面,建议自己在服务器上搭建自己的靶场,如何搭建靶场请订阅并查看作者上期教程,这里作者先为大家推荐一个免费开源升级靶场:https://hack.zkaq.cn/   在封神台 ...

  2. jdk下载安装配置环境变量

    因为学习原因要用到一些工具,jdk12的版本与那个工具不兼容,所以这里推荐使用的是jdk1.8的版本, 不知道是电脑原因还是啥原因,jdk 12的版本用不了配不好环境变量. 首先可以在官网下载jdk1 ...

  3. mongoDB 安装和配置环境变量,超详细版本

    下载mongoDB进行安装:https://www.mongodb.com/                                                 到Community Se ...

  4. JDK下载安装与环境变量配置图文教程【超详细】

    JDK下载安装与环境变量配置图文教程[超详细] 创建时间:2019年11月13日11时02分 文章目录 1. JDK介绍 1.1 什么是JDK? 1.2 JDK版本介绍 2. JDK下载与安装 3.w ...

  5. JBOSS EAP6.2.0的下载安装、环境变量配置以及部署

    JBOSS EAP6.2.0的下载安装.环境变量配置以及部署 JBoss是纯Java的EJB(企业JavaBean)server. 第一步:下载安装 1.进入官网http://www.jboss.or ...

  6. jdk11下载安装及环境变量配置

    jdk11下载安装及环境变量配置 官网地址:https://www.oracle.com/technetwork/java/javase/downloads/jdk11-downloads-50666 ...

  7. JDK-13下载安装及环境变量配置

    1.JDK-13下载安装及环境变量配置 直接去官网下载 附下载链接:https://www.oracle.com/technetwork/java/javase/downloads/index.htm ...

  8. Windows10下JDK8的下载安装与环境变量的配置

    Windows10下JDK8的下载安装与环境变量的配置 下载JDK8(64位) 链接:https://pan.baidu.com/s/10ZMK7NB68kPORZsPOhivog 提取码:agsa ...

  9. 安装选择msi格式还是zip(windows下Nodejs zip版下载安装及环境变量配置)

    安装选择msi格式还是zip((windows下Nodejs zip版下载安装及环境变量配置)) -----以node.js 安装为例: 1,外观对比: ✿ 简单介绍一下node的作用: • node ...

随机推荐

  1. 【学习笔记】tensorflow图片读取

    目录 图像基本概念 图像基本操作 图像基本操作API 图像读取API 狗图片读取 CIFAR-10二进制数据读取 TFRecords TFRecords存储 TFRecords读取方法 图像基本概念 ...

  2. Xshell工具使用--连接VMware虚拟机

    假设有这样的场景,开发者用的是Windows系统,且系统的存储资源和内存有限,在运行VMware虚拟机中做一些测试时,通常会碍于电脑的VMWare客户端图形界面的响应速度太慢.而在Xshell中对虚拟 ...

  3. 深入了解Object.defineProperty

    原来写文章都是一次写两三个小时写完,偶尔看到一个人的博客了解到还有草稿箱这个功能,所以以后写文章的时候就舒服多了哈哈,可以存起来再发,不需要一口气写完了 最近一直在看JavaScript高级程序设计, ...

  4. C#与SQL Server数据库连接

    using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.T ...

  5. 重装助手教你如何禁用Windows 10快速启动

    快速启动是首先在Windows 8中实现并延续到Windows 10的功能,可在启动PC时提供更快的启动时间.它是一个方便的功能,也是大多数人在不知情的情况下使用的功能,但还有一些功能会在他们掌握新P ...

  6. Saltstack_使用指南06_远程执行-指定目标

    1. 主机规划 Targeting Minions文档 https://docs.saltstack.com/en/latest/contents.html 另请参见:自动化运维神器之saltstac ...

  7. 使用Visual Studio Code进行ABAP开发

    长期以来,我们都使用SAP GUI进行ABAP编码工作,事务代码SE38甚至成了ABAP的代名词. SAP GUI的代码编辑能力和一些专业的IDE比较起来难免相形见绌,为了给开发者们更好的体验,SAP ...

  8. Jenkins插件之显示构建时间

    1.进入jenkin插件管理器中,安装  Timestamper 插件 2.安装完成后,进入到构建任务里面,在 构建环境 中勾选  Add timestamps to the Console Outp ...

  9. 超哥笔记 --nginx入门(6)

    一 NGINX 1 nignx是什么 nginx是一个开源的支持高性能,高并发的web服务和代理服务软件. nginx比他大哥apache性能改进许多,nginx占用的系统资源更少,支持高并发连接,有 ...

  10. Python开发【内置模块篇】datetime

    获取当前日期和时间 >>> from datetime import datetime >>> now = datetime.now() >>> ...